Mary - Five Months

Mary turned five months yesterday!!! We don't go to the doctor this month so I don't have any stats on how tall or how much she weighs. We don't own a scale so I can't even guesstimate. She is still her happy self and just loves talking out loud. She takes her good nap in the morning from about 9/10 to 12/1. Any nap after that is just a cat nap, but honestly it's ok because she is happy most of the time.


I'm pretty sure she is teething because she is a drooly monster and loves sticking anything and everything into her mouth, unless it is a binky. She does not take one and at this point who cares because it is one less thing to have to get rid of.

She still does not roll over. I don't think she really cares but she is giving her mother anxiety. She gets all the way to her side and then just stops, plays and rolls back to her back. She has however mastered slamming her legs onto her crib mattress. WOW that girl can kick.
